Skåne Sjælland Linux User Group - http://www.sslug.dk Forside   Tilmelding   Postarkiv   Forum   Kalender   Søg
MhonArc Dato: [Date Prev] [Kronologisk oversigt] [Date Next]   Tråd: [Date Prev] [Oversigt tråde] [Date Next]   MhonArc
 

RE: [PERL] Authentication med AuthenURL



On Wed, 29 Oct 2003 sslug@sslug wrote:

> >> Jeg har en password beskyttet webside som benytter .htaccess, på en
> >> apache server. Jeg vil gerne benytte denne password beskyttelse fra et
> >> perl CGI script.

> Nope, CGI scriptet er ikke beskyttet af .htaccess, det har jeg desværre
> ikke mulighed for...

OK - Jeg misforstod dig.

> Jeg vil gerne validere op imod en anden side som er adgangs beskyttet, i
> dette tilfælde er det en side der ligger i et Lotus Notes system,

Så du vil gerne proxie din kontrol af brugernavn/kodeord til en anden
server?

Grundlæggende skal du jo så:

 - Have en form eller noget htaccess (via en mod_perl hook) så du får 
   brugerens bud på et brugernavn/koderod.

 - Bruge LWP el.l. til at forspørge en beskyttet webside på notes-serveren 
   ved hjælp af det angivne brugernavn/kodeords par.

 - Give adgang hvis du får noget fornuftigt tilbage fra notes serveren 
   (200 som status fx).

Hvis du bruger mod_perl/htaccess skal du nok cache det så den ikke skal
checke ved hver request.

Med en form skal du så bare bruge noget URL eller cookie authentificering
for under den aktuelle session.

Jeg har vidst engang lavet noget ligende dog baseret på en POP3 server
(ren form baseret) og en der ud fra en række MySQL tabeller authentifikere
(via en mod_perl/htpassword hook). Så det kan sagtens lade sig gøre.

Hvis jeg har forstået dig ret så langt, men ovenstående ikke er en hjælp,
må du nok være mere specifik med hvilken del der volder problemer.

-- 

Med velig hilsen

Martin Lorensen




 
Forside   Tilmelding   Postarkiv   Oversigt   Kalender   Søg

 
 
Henvendelse vedrørende websiderne til <www_admin>. Senest ændret 2005-08-10, klokken 19:55
Denne side vedligeholdes af MHonArc .